About 1 billion people live … WebNorth America is a continent in Earth’s Northern and Western Hemispheres. It contains the countries Canada, Mexico, USA, and many others. In terms of area, it’s the third-largest continent, after Asia and Africa. This huge size means that North America is host to a diverse range of climates and habitats.
